Как работает кеширование сведений
Кеширование данных представляет собой технологию сохранения дубликатов информации в быстром хранилище. Система генерирует дубликаты нередко запрашиваемых файлов и размещает их ближе к клиенту. Процесс запускается с первичного обращения к ресурсу, когда данные скачиваются из основного источника и одновременно сохраняются в выделенном хранилище.
При очередном обращении система проверяет наличие необходимой данных в кэше. Если дубликат выявлена и свежа, скачивание выполняется из промежуточного хранилища. Такой подход уменьшает время ответа, поскольку сведения извлекаются из памяти устройства вавада вместо отдаленного сервера.
Принцип функционирования основан на принципе близости. Система изучает паттерны запросов и устанавливает наиболее востребованные элементы. Изображения, сценарии, таблицы стилей попадают в кэш самостоятельно после первичного загрузки страницы.
Методика применяет разнообразные уровни хранения. Процессор использует внутреннюю память для инструкций. Операционная система использует оперативную память для программных информации. Веб-приложения записывают контент на диске клиента через vavada механизмы браузера, обеспечивая мгновенный доступ к файлам.
Что такое кэш понятными словами
Кэш представляет собой переходное хранилище для временных дубликатов информации. Методика позволяет системе сохранять данные, которая может понадобиться вновь. Вместо новой загрузки файлов устройство использует записанные копии из локального хранилища.
Механизм работы похож блокнот с пометками. Человек записывает важные информацию, чтобы не находить их заново в руководстве. Компьютер работает аналогично, сохраняя фрагменты веб-страниц, изображения, видеофайлы в выделенной области памяти. При следующем запросе система использует эти копии вместо исходного источника.
Буферное хранилище находится на различных слоях архитектуры. Процессор содержит индивидуальный кэш для ускорения вычислений. Жесткий диск хранит информацию браузера и программ. Оперативная память удерживает работающие процессы для быстрого доступа.
Размер кэша ограничен аппаратными ресурсами устройства. Система автоматически регулирует наполнением, стирая неактуальные данные и очищая место для актуальных. Клиент может воздействовать на казино вавада конфигурации хранилища, изменяя опции браузера или удаляя сохраненные файлы вручную.
Зачем системам сохранять временные копии информации
Главная цель хранения временных дубликатов состоит в уменьшении времени доступа к информации. Системы избегают повторных запросов к дистанционным серверам, задействуя местные копии файлов. Скорость выгрузки сведений из памяти устройства превосходит темп загрузки через сеть в десятки раз.
Сокращение сетевого трафика является существенным плюсом методики. Клиенты с ограниченным интернет-пакетом расходуют меньше мегабайт при изучении известных ресурсов. Браузер загружает лишь свежие элементы страницы, а остальной содержимое берет из вавада локального хранилища.
Уменьшение нагрузки на серверы дает выполнять больше запросов синхронно. Сайты отдают статические файлы реже, концентрируясь на изменяемом материале. Распределение задач между клиентским кэшем и серверной структурой увеличивает общую скорость.
Независимая работа программ гарантируется благодаря сохраненным копиям. Пользователь может просматривать прежде полученные страницы без связи к сети. Портативные приложения применяют кэшированные данные при неустойчивом связи, обеспечивая доступ к возможностям даже в обстоятельствах слабой коннекта.
Как кэш ускоряет загрузку страниц и программ
Повышение скачивания обеспечивается за счет устранения задержек сетевого подключения. Браузер выгружает сохраненные файлы из локальной памяти за миллисекунды, тогда как запрос к серверу отнимает сотни миллисекунд. Отличие оказывается особенно явной при низкоскоростном интернете или отдаленном размещении хранилища.
Неизменные компоненты веб-страниц загружаются моментально благодаря кэшированию. Логотипы, гарнитуры, таблицы стилей, скрипты фиксируются после первого визита. При очередном открытии ресурса система применяет подготовленные элементы из vavada буферного хранилища, направляя запросы лишь для обновленного контента.
Приложения применяют многоуровневое кэширование для улучшения производительности. Операционная система содержит библиотеки в оперативной памяти. Приложения хранят клиентские параметры на диске. Такая организация позволяет открывать приложения скорее и перемещаться между задачами без пауз.
Предварительная загрузка ресурсов повышает скорость перемещения. Браузер исследует архитектуру ресурса и предварительно записывает элементы смежных страниц. Клиент кликает по линкам почти мгновенно, поскольку требуемые файлы уже размещены в кэше устройства.
Где используется кэш: браузер, сервер, устройство
Браузеры записывают веб-контент в отдельной директории на жестком диске юзера. Изображения, видеофайлы, таблицы стилей, JavaScript-файлы попадают в хранилище автоматически при изучении веб-страниц. Каждый браузер регулирует собственным кэшем независимо от других программ.
Хранилища задействуют кеширование для снижения нагрузки на базы данных. Подготовленные HTML-страницы записываются в памяти вместо создания при любом запросе. Промежуточные прокси-серверы содержат популярный материал, разделяя его между клиентами. Сети передачи контента размещают копии файлов в разных географических точках.
Процессоры включают интегрированные уровни кэша для команд и сведений. L1-кэш располагается напрямую в ядре и предоставляет мгновенный доступ. L2 и L3 слои обладают больший объем, но работают медленнее. Многоуровневая структура оптимизирует соотношение между быстродействием и емкостью хранилища казино вавада.
Операционные системы кешируют файлы и библиотеки в оперативной памяти. Нередко применяемые программы загружаются быстрее благодаря предварительному помещению элементов. Портативные устройства хранят данные программ местно, предоставляя работу при отсутствии подключения к интернету.
Что происходит при обновлении информации
При актуализации данных на хранилище возникает конфликт между текущей версией и сохраненной копией. Система обязана определить, какая данные неактуальна и требует обновления. Браузер анализирует отметки времени файлов и сопоставляет их с сохраненными копиями.
Хранилища задействуют выделенные заголовки для управления процессом обновления. Настройки указывают период актуальности сохраненного содержимого и условия его употребления. Когда время существования дубликата заканчивается, браузер посылает запрос для верификации актуальности vavada через инструмент валидации.
Процесс согласования охватывает несколько шагов:
- Проверка периода действия сохраненных файлов по временным отметкам
- Отсылка условного обращения на сервер для сравнения редакций
- Скачивание обновленного содержимого при обнаружении правок
- Обновление неактуальных дубликатов актуальными данными в хранилище
Методики актуализации варьируются в зависимости от вида контента. Постоянные элементы могут сохраняться долгое время без контроля. Динамические страницы нуждаются регулярной проверки. Программисты устанавливают стратегии кэширования отдельно для каждого типа файлов.
Почему иногда кэш создает сбои показа
Ошибки визуализации образуются из-за применения устаревших версий файлов. Браузер скачивает записанные копии вместо актуального содержимого с хранилища. Клиент видит устаревший дизайн страницы, сломанные возможности или неправильное расположение элементов.
Столкновение версий случается при актуализации сайта разработчиками. Новые стили и сценарии несовместимы со устаревшими HTML-шаблонами из кэша. Страница вавада собирается из компонентов различных поколений, что влечет к графическим искажениям через объединение несогласованных элементов.
Порча кэшированных информации создает сбои в функционировании программ. Файлы могут быть зафиксированы не частично из-за разрыва соединения или ошибок диска. Браузер старается применить испорченные копии, что ведет к отсутствию картинок или неправильной структуре.
Неправильные конфигурации срока действия кэша вызывают трудности синхронизации. Сервер указывает чрезмерно продолжительный срок хранения для переменного материала. Клиент продолжает видеть устаревшую данные даже после размещения модификаций. Браузер не контролирует свежесть информации до истечения установленного времени.
Как стирается и актуализируется кэш
Автоматическое очищение происходит по достижении ограничения дискового пространства. Браузер удаляет устаревшие файлы по принципу вытеснения, высвобождая пространство для новых данных. Система изучает частоту обращений к копиям и убирает наименее запрашиваемые компоненты.
Мануальная очистка осуществляется через настройки браузера или программы. Юзер указывает срок стирания сведений и виды файлов для очищения. Операция удаляет все сохраненные копии, принуждая систему скачивать материал вновь через vavada повторное запрос к хранилищам.
Жесткое обновление страницы позволяет скачать новую редакцию без полной удаления кэша. Сочетание клавиш минует местное хранилище и получает все компоненты с сервера. Браузер обновляет неактуальные дубликаты актуальными файлами.
Софтверное контроль кэшем осуществляется через специальные средства разработчика. Плагины браузера автоматизируют механизм удаления по графику. Серверные конфигурации регулируют политику обновления через заголовки ответов, определяя срок актуальности каждого типа контента и условия проверки информации.
Преимущество кеширования для быстродействия и нагрузки
Кэширование радикально сокращает время отклика сайтов и программ. Пользователь получает доступ к контенту за доли секунды вместо ожидания загрузки с удаленного хранилища. Быстрое открытие страниц повышает впечатление службы и увеличивает лояльность пользователей.
Сокращение нагрузки на серверную инфраструктуру обеспечивает обрабатывать больше клиентов параллельно. Сайты сохраняют вычислительные ресурсы и пропускную способность каналов коммуникации. Разделение постоянного содержимого через кэш высвобождает мощности для выполнения динамических запросов через улучшение организации системы казино вавада.
Сокращение трафика становится критичной для портативных устройств с лимитированными тарифами. Последующие посещения на сайты не расходуют мегабайты из плана юзера. Приложения загружают лишь измененные сведения, сокращая количество транслируемой информации.
Стабильность работы увеличивается благодаря местным копиям информации. Кратковременные сбои сети не перекрывают доступ к прежде скачанному содержимому. Юзер продолжает взаимодействовать с программой даже при нестабильном связи, а система обновляет изменения после возобновления связи.
